Top Story

Webcasts of Geospatial Web Services 2008

The Geospatial Web Services workshop at Centre for Geospatial Science, University of Nottingham held June 16-17th, 2008 had an interesting twist: a live webcast. More than 300 viewers followed the presentations over two days. Organizer Dr. Suchith Anand of the University wants to share the content as he believes "technologies like webcasting and podcasting will help in widening participation of GIS research conferences and events for the benefit of the society at large."


off the beaten path

The OhMyGov! website (motto: "America Love It or Fix It") maintains a map of missing and stolen government "stuff" such as laptops and hard drives. The idea is that website readers can be on the lookout for the items, and possibly help get them back to the rightful owners. Used with permission. Click for larger image.
